Business
Aeria Ltd. is an internet-related company founded in 1998, forming a group comprising 27 consolidated subsidiaries and 1 equity-method affiliate. Its business consists of three segments: IT Services (Affiliate Platform and Data Services), Content (Smartphone Games development/distribution and Character Merchandise sales), and Asset Management (real estate sales, rental management, accommodation facility operation, and Investment). Major customers include mobile game users (sales to Apple Inc. of ¥2,778 million, 16.9%, and to Google Inc. of ¥1,870 million, 11.4%), as well as a wide range of real estate investors and corporate clients. Under the keyword "communication," the company upholds as its management philosophy the creation of indispensable services in the networked society.
Business Model
The Content segment centers on a freemium model where games themselves are provided free of charge and revenue is generated through in-game item purchases. The IT Services segment secures stable revenue through fee income from the Affiliate Platform and Data Services revenue such as managed hosting. The Asset Management segment generates revenue through the selective sale of investment real estate, leasing, and operation of accommodation facilities. In terms of revenue composition for FY2025 (ending December 2025), Content accounted for 56.7%, Asset Management 33.2%, and IT Services 10.7%, while in terms of profit, Asset Management is the largest contributing segment.

ENVALITH's Perspective
Performance Trend
Revenue over the past five fiscal years peaked at ¥22,671 million in FY2023 (ended December 2023) before contracting to ¥16,472 million in FY2025 (ended December 2025). In 1Q FY2026 (ending December 2026), revenue turned upward to ¥4,656 million (+16.4% YoY), driven mainly by a 99.9% YoY surge in sales of real estate held for sale within the Asset Management business. However, gross margin declined due to higher cost of sales, and operating profit fell to ¥222 million (-30.6% YoY), with EBITDA also down to ¥240 million (-31.3% YoY), indicating deteriorating profitability. As an external factor, soaring prices and declining yields for investment real estate have led to a shortage of suitable deals, constraining sustainable profit growth in the Asset Management business. Achieving the full-year operating profit forecast of ¥900 million will require a substantial improvement in performance in the second half.
Growth Strategy
Expanding the revenue base through synergy enhancement across three business segments, deepening niche markets, and leveraging M&A
The policy is to focus on smaller-scale investment properties with shorter business periods, securing stable earnings while controlling business risk. Operations continue to be managed cautiously in light of financial institutions' lending stance and other factors. In 1Q FY2026 (ending March 2026), completion and settlement of properties held for sale progressed smoothly, achieving revenue growth of 99.9% year-on-year.
The company is promoting a shift from mass markets to targeted niche markets, while strengthening the development, distribution, and operation of Smartphone Games for smartphones and tablets. However, in 1Q FY2026 (ending March 2026), revenue from existing Content and merchandise sales declined, resulting in revenue of ¥1,875 million (-21.3% year-on-year) and operating profit of ¥6 million (-92.5% year-on-year), representing a significant divergence from plan.
EBITDA has been adopted as a key management indicator, and a framework for company comparisons and M&A evaluation that transcends differences in accounting standards across countries has been put in place. From 1Q FY2026 (ending March 2026), Epoch In Shinsaibashi Co., Ltd. was newly added to the scope of consolidation, expanding the business foundation of Asset Management. The company continues to actively pursue expansion of business scale through M&A.
While maintaining stable earnings from Data Services through Air Net Co., Ltd., the company aims to achieve a recovery in earnings from the Affiliate Platform business of First Penguin Co., Ltd. In 1Q FY2026 (ending March 2026), revenue declined to ¥410 million (-8.2% year-on-year) and operating profit fell to ¥9 million (-49.2% year-on-year) due to decreases in payment processing revenue and affiliate advertising revenue, with the downturn continuing; improvement is an urgent priority.
